dc.descriptionHybrid partitioning has been recognized as a technique to achieve query optimization in relational and object -oriented databases. Due to the increasing availability of multimedia applications, there is an interest in using partitioning techniques in multimedia da tabases in order to take advantage of the reduction in the number of pages required to answer a query and to minimize data exchange among sites. Never theless, until now only vertical and horizontal partitioning have been used in multimedia databases. This paper presents a hybrid partitioning method for multimedia databases. This method takes into account the size of the attributes and the selectivity of the predicates in order to generate hybrid partitioning schemes that reduce the execution cost of the que ries. A cost model for evaluating hybrid partitioning schemes in distributed multimedia databases was developed. Experiments in a multimedia database benchmark were performed in order to demonstrate the efficiency of our ap proach.
